Abstract
INTRODUCTION: Internal neck anatomy landmarks and their relation after placement of an extraglottic airway devices have not been studied extensively by the use of ultrasound. Based on our group experience with external landmarks as well as internal landmarks evaluation with other techniques, we aimed use ultrasound to analyze the internal neck anatomy landmarks and the related changes due to the placement of the Laryngeal Mask Airway Unique.Entities:

Guidelines for measuring external and internal landmarks
| Landmark | Description |
|---|---|
| Hyoid mental distance (HMD) | Lower midline border of mandible in jaw occlusion extended to upper border of hyoid bone |
| Thyroid mental distance (TMD) | Mentum as per HMD extended to thyroid notch |
| Sternal mental distance (SMD) | Mentum as per HMD extended to sternal notch |
| Hyoid thyroid distance (HTD) | Upper border of hyoid bone extended to thyroid noth |
| Hyoid cricoid cartilage distance (HCD) | Hyroid bone to upper border of cricoid cartilage |
| Thyroid height (TH) | Thyroid notch to lower border of cricoid cartilage |
| Thyroid cricoid distance (TCD) | Thyroid notch to upper border of cricoid cartilage |
| Thyroid width (TW) | Lateral border of upper thyroid cartilage |
External neck landmarks were measured with a tape measure; internal neck landmarks with a digital caliper. Images were combined and distances summated if too large to fit in one picture.
